Overview of Role

Please give an overview of your role and what this involves on a day-to-day basis:
4/5
I assist my Relationship Manager in looking after his Portfolio of clients. On a day to day basis, I play a vital role in drawing down loans, opening accounts, answering emails and phone calls. In addition this, I attend regular meetings both internally and externally.

Skills Development

Have you learnt any new skills or developed existing skills?
3/5
The qualifications I am working towards include: Level 3 Senior Customer Advisor in Financial Services, Professional Banker Certificate and my Certificate in Lending. I complete regular training courses in: Competition Law, Risk Management and diversity and inclusion. Within in my role, I have developed my customer service skills.

Structure and Support

How well organised/structured is your programme?
3/5
From day one I was thrown into the job, learning as I went along. The introduction was thorough and set me up well. The training has been ongoing and I am well supported by my colleagues. I have one day a week dedicated to studying.
How much support do you receive from your employer?
3/5
I have regular check ins with my line manager, as well as plenty support available on the intranet site. My colleagues are also always available to support me.
How much support do you receive from your training provider when working towards your qualifications?
3/5
I have monthly check ins with my training provider as well as a dedicated learning hub online.
